This is what happens to a place where there's an active underground mine fire burning for 40 years. The mountain is completely on fire. The road is fucked up becuase the ground is caving in. And yes that is smoke comming out of the crack in the road. Anywhere in Centrillia if you touch the ground it feels hot no matter what time of year it is.
